2015-10-09 2 views
5

Obecnie używam ihaskell, aby dowiedzieć się o niektórych bibliotekach. IHaskell nadal jest niebezpieczny, a ja nie mogę zrobić:Czy istnieje polecenie dwukropka ghci, aby ukryć paczkę?

-- This doesn't work: ":ext PackageImports", the kernel hangs 
-- This doesn't work: "{-# LANGUAGE PackageImports #-}", the kernel hangs 
import Codec.Crypto.RSA.Pure 
import qualified "crypto-api" Crypto.Random           as CR 
import   Control.Monad.CryptoRandom 

Bez „PackageImports”, pojawia się komunikat o błędzie:

Ambiguous interface for ‘Crypto.Random’: it was found in multiple packages: crypto-api-0.13.2 cryptonite-0.7 

Moje pytanie brzmi, czy istnieje komenda okrężnicy wewnątrz ghci który pozwoliłby do ukrycia pakietu cryptonite?

Odpowiedz

6

Tak.

:set -hide-package cryptonite 
+0

Dzięki, niestety nie jest jeszcze zaimplementowany przez iHaskell – dsign